What Is HydraFacial?
This signature treatment has become the world's most popular non-invasive facial. HydraFacial's unique spiral tip simultaneously removes impurities while infusing beneficial serums, leaving skin instantly refreshed.

How Does HydraFacial Work?
The treatment follows a three-step process: cleanse and exfoliate with gentle resurfacing, extract impurities with painless suction while infusing hydration, then saturate skin with antioxidants and peptides.

5 Is there any downtime after a HydraFacial?
No, HydraFacial has zero downtime. Skin looks immediately radiant. You can apply makeup and resume normal activities right away.
6 Does HydraFacial hurt?
No, HydraFacial is painless. Most patients find the experience relaxing. You may feel light suction during extraction, which isn't uncomfortable. Wadsworth med spas follow the same protocols with local expertise.
7 How long does a HydraFacial take?
Standard treatments take 30-45 minutes. Premium packages with add-ons like LED therapy or lymphatic drainage take 60-90 minutes. Consult a Wadsworth provider for personalized guidance.
